CourseDetails
โข Evolutionary Theory: An in-depth examination of the fundamental theories and concepts in evolutionary biology, including natural selection, genetic drift, and gene flow.
โข Anthropology of Care: An overview of the anthropological study of care, including the evolution of caregiving behaviors and their cultural and societal implications.
โข Comparative Primatology: A comparative analysis of primate behavior, social structures, and communication, with a focus on the evolutionary origins of human behaviors.
โข Evolution of Human Sociality: An exploration of the evolution of human social behaviors, including cooperation, altruism, and reciprocity.
โข Evolution of Parenting and Child Development: A study of the evolution of parenting strategies and the developmental consequences of different caregiving arrangements.
โข Evolution of Emotions and Empathy: An examination of the evolution of emotions and empathy, with a focus on their role in human social behavior and caregiving.
โข Evolutionary Medicine: An introduction to the application of evolutionary principles to the understanding of human health and disease.
โข Research Methods in Evolutionary Anthropology: A review of the research methods and techniques used in the study of evolutionary anthropology, including field observations, experiments, and comparative analysis.
